SPRINGFIELD
– Memorial Medical Center will host a free introductory session for
athletes and active adults over 40 years old at 6 p.m. Tuesday, Aug.
22, at Memorial SportsCare.
The 90-minute program will feature Dr. Nicole Florence and Dr. David
Sandercock, both internal medicine physicians and pediatricians with
Memorial Physician Services-Koke Mill, and Dr. Rodney Herrin,
SportsCare’s co-medical director and an orthopedic surgeon with the
Orthopedic Center of Illinois in Springfield.
The free session introduces the 10-week Over-40 Fitness program
offered by Memorial SportsCare.
[to top of second column] |
The physicians will discuss the unique challenges and health
considerations to help adults over 40 get back into shape without injury as well
as how physical and nutritional needs change with age.
